Questa pagina descrive come collegare, scollegare ed elencare i tag nelle risorse Dataproc Metastore. Per una panoramica dei tag in Dataproc Metastore, consulta Organizzare le risorse di Dataproc Metastore utilizzando i tag.
Prima di iniziare
Per ottenere le autorizzazioni necessarie per visualizzare e impostare i tag sulle risorse Dataproc Metastore, chiedi all'amministratore di concederti i seguenti ruoli IAM nel progetto:
-
Editor Dataproc Metastore (
roles/metastore.editor
): assegna per impostare e visualizzare i tag -
Visualizzatore Dataproc Metastore (
roles/metastore.viewer
): assegna i tag di visualizzazione
Per saperne di più sulla concessione dei ruoli, consulta Gestire l'accesso a progetti, cartelle e organizzazioni.
Potresti anche riuscire a ottenere le autorizzazioni richieste tramite i ruoli personalizzati o altri ruoli predefiniti.
Lavorare con i tag
Dopo aver creato e definito un tag utilizzando Resource Manager, puoi iniziare a utilizzare i tag con il servizio Dataproc Metastore e le risorse di federazione. Per ulteriori informazioni sui comandi gcloud CLI per utilizzare le associazioni di tag, consulta gcloud resource-manager tags bindings.
Per tutti i comandi in questa pagina, sostituisci quanto segue:
PARENT_PATH
: il percorso completo della risorsa del servizio o della federazione, ad esempio//metastore.googleapis.com/projects/my-project/locations/us-central1/services/my-service
.TAG_VALUE
: il valore del tag che vuoi associare alla risorsa. Ad esempio, il valore del tag impostato come815471563813/environment/development
include i seguenti componenti:815471563813
è l'ID organizzazione o l'ID progetto.environment
è la chiave del tag.development
è il valore del tag.
LOCATION
: la regione in cui si trova il servizio o la federazione, ad esempious-central1
.
Associare tag alle risorse Dataproc Metastore
gcloud resource-manager tags bindings create \ --parent=PARENT_PATH \ --tag-value=TAG_VALUE \ --location=LOCATION
Scollegare i tag dalle risorse Dataproc Metastore
gcloud resource-manager tags bindings delete \ --parent=PARENT_PATH \ --tag-value=TAG_VALUE \ --location=LOCATION
Elenca i tag nelle risorse Dataproc Metastore
gcloud resource-manager tags bindings list \ --parent=PARENT_PATH \ --location=LOCATION